Who should conduct tear gas cleanup?
Tear gas cleanup is best performed by professionals with expertise in hazardous materials remediation. These specialists have the necessary training, equipment, and experience to safely and effectively remove tear gas residue. Attempting to clean up tear gas residue without proper training and equipment can pose health risks and may result in incomplete removal.

What are the financial implications of fentanyl contamination in properties?
Fentanyl contamination can lead to substantial financial burdens for property owners. Decontamination and restoration costs are often high, requiring specialized equipment and certified professionals. In addition to cleanup expenses, contaminated properties may experience reduced market value, becoming challenging to sell or lease. Families may also face ongoing healthcare costs due to exposure-related health issues. Addressing these financial implications promptly with professional services is essential to minimizing long-term losses.
